"Tennessee Orange" — the 2022 TikTok-broken single that climbed to No. 4 on the Billboard Country Airplay chart and made Moroney the first solo female country artist since 2009 to chart a debut single inside the top ten without prior label promotion — anchors the back half of the main set as the first guaranteed full-room singalong of the night, with the entire amphitheater or theatre singing the chorus loud enough that Moroney occasionally steps off the mic and lets the room carry the line. "Am I Okay?" — the title track and lead single off the 2024 sophomore album that won the CMT Music Awards' Female Video of the Year and pushed the album to a top-five debut on the all-genre Billboard 200 — typically lands in the mid-set arc as the emotional centerpiece of the night and gets the longest reaction on most current legs. "I'm Not Pretty" — the third single off the 2023 debut Lucky and Moroney's first country-radio top-twenty hit — lands in the early-set hit run a third of the way through the night and gets the first full-room singalong. "Heaven by Noon" — the second single off Am I Okay? and the song Kristian Bush co-produced as the pedal-steel showcase — typically sits in the acoustic-feel mid-set block alongside "28th of June" and "I Know You". The typical structure is a 75-to-95-minute set with no intermission, no choreography and no backing tracks — Moroney fronts a tight six-piece road band (pedal steel, electric guitar, bass, drums, fiddle and keyboards) and works the catalogue front-to-back with stripped-back production. Encore is typically a single track — "Tennessee Orange" if she closed the main set on "Am I Okay?", or the reverse — and occasionally she rolls a Taylor Swift, Patty Loveless or Lee Ann Womack cover into the acoustic mid-set block depending on the city. Does the Megan Moroney Setlist Change Night to Night?
The core of the Megan Moroney 2026 setlist — the singles and the staging — stays consistent across the tour so production cues work from night to night. Smaller changes (a deep cut swap, a city-specific cover, or an acoustic surprise) happen on some nights.
